Naming the Press


The Hermetic Press is named after one of the Troyer ornaments cast by American Type Foundry. A scarab. The device embodied my vision of the private press: individual, self-contained, impenetrable. It also suggested my interest in visual poetry and semiotics. Settling on it was like setting a line of type and finding that the last character made for a perfect fit.

I only used the device once, as a printer’s mark on a title page; but now some forty years later, these divagations on printing and poetry seem the ideal place for it to reappear.
